Pickup Suspected Of Damaging Cashmere High Baseball Fields
Chelan County Sheriff's deputies are asking for public help to track down the owner of a pickup truck that they say caused significant damage to the Cashmere High School baseball fields grass.
The truck is a 1990’s Chevrolet Z71 model with a step side bed and no tail gate.
It appears in surveillance video to be leaving the area in the early morning hours on Saturday.
"This occurred in the early morning hours of Saturday, just after midnight," said Foreman. "The vehicle was out doing donuts, did numerous spins in the outfield causing damage to the grass."
The pickup then drove around Cashmere High School and and left through the parking lot, where it was caught by video cameras.
Foreman says the driver could face felony charges, depending on the level of damage.
"It's going to be a combination of the damage to replace the grass and the total amount of hours it'll take to get that fixed," Forman said. "They'll (the school district) will come up with a number, and that's what we'll use to determine the degree on the charge for malicious mischief."

In a separate incident earlier this year, a car ripped up a good portion of the new grass and damaged some of the irrigation system at the refurbished Lincoln Park in Wenatchee.
That vandalism took place days before the park was reopened back in May.
The damage took several weeks to repair.
